Job Summary - 

The Forensic Accounting Analyst will review financial statements and other records of listed companies available in the public domain and provide detailed analysis to help uncover essential facts and insights. He will support the equity research team and provide institutional clients of the firm with deep insights based on forensic analysis.

In-depth knowledge of the balance sheet, income statement, and statement of cash flow requires an understanding of how changes of consistent or inconsistent trending patterns impact the income statement and cash flow.

Your ability to determine inconsistencies, or unexplainable changes in the income statement and balance sheet will assist you in the beginning stage of forensic financial analysis. Your ability to acquire an investigative perseverance requires an ability to analyze below the surface. Expert knowledge of Accounting Standards and their impact on financial statements is imperative.

Job Description - 

I] Forensic Accounting

Forensic Accounting Analyst will undertake detailed accounting investigations and assessments of accounting irregularities such as:

- Interpretation of accounting standards and assessment of the propriety of accounting treatment for specific transactions under various accounting standard setting regimes, including IndAS, International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S), US GAAP and UK GAAP versions of Indian companies

- Investigation and analysis of allegations of fraudulent or false accounting

- Analysis and tracing of funds and transactions

- Impact of change in accounting policies or estimates

- Analyze the financial condition by performing a horizontal and vertical analysis of the balance sheet and income statement. The use of industry standard statistics is essential in the analytical process, as a means of verifying the condition of ratios and financials in relation to standards.

II] Financial Analysis

He will provide analyses of financial statements and other accounting information to clients interested in gaining a better understanding of specific companies which may include - 

- Assessments of accounting profitability and economic profitability of a company, investment or project

- Analysis of balance sheet metrics, including capital adequacy, risk-adjusted return on capital, short- and long-term funding requirements

- Analysis of complex capital structures and company leverage

- Liquidity and solvency assessments

- Assessment of appropriate post-acquisition price adjustments arising from discrepancies between the expected and actual balance sheet or working capital values

These assessments of company financial and accounting data can help to illustrate a company's performance over time or show how a company may have been affected by specific events.

Forensic Accounting Analyst will identify/investigate financial statement frauds like:

- fictitious sales

- improper expense recognition

- incorrect asset valuation

- hidden liabilities

- unsuitable disclosures
